More about Master of Clinical Exercise Physiology
If you're considering pursuing a Master of Clinical Exercise Physiology in New South Wales, you're in luck! The state is home to several reputable training providers that offer this qualification, including the Australian Catholic University (ACU) and the University of Wollongong (UOW). Both of these institutions deliver courses on campus, providing an excellent opportunity for students who thrive in face-to-face learning environments.
